PostPosted: Tue May 10, 2005 8:07 pm    Post subject: what stage to use w/ Pentium M processor Reply with quote

I am installing G2 2005.0 on a Pentium M Dell laptop. I have read where people are successfully running G2 on this model (Dell Lattitude D600). What stage should I use?

PostPosted: Tue May 10, 2005 8:53 pm    Post subject: Reply with quote

The x86 Stage 1 and optimize for pentium4 if you can leave the machine running (compiling) for a longer while.
Stage 3 (most likely you want the one for pentium4) if you just wanna load some binaries. Note that the first update will compile many of the packages you'd have compiled in stage1 too nevertheless, as they mostly have been updated.

Be sure to use the 2005.0 releases and read the manual. 'n get some coffee if you drink that. :D

EDIT: I forgot to mention this: The mobile extensions on your cpu and mainboard are gonna be supported by the kernel and some user space programs; as they're not implementing some special CPU extensions to speed up your machine (like mmx or sse), they're not relevant when compiling...
